Woman who died after ‘falling from UK city building' is pictured as tributes paid to ‘widely-respected' charity worker

A WOMAN who tragically died after falling from a building in a busy city centre has been named. Rachel O'Hare, in her 40s, was pronounced dead at the scene in the heart of Manchester on Monday, June 30, after falling to her death. Tributes have now poured in for the widely-respected charity fundraiser, who co-founded a group which worked to help vulnerable women in refuges. Her charity Elle for Elle aimed to support women in need with basic toiletries and beauty products, with the charity's work said to have been praised in Westminster. More to follow... Wildlife refuge group taps Lynn Scarlett as board chair

Lynn Scarlett knows her way around the nation's wildlife refuges. Now, the former deputy Interior secretary will see them in a new light, as chair of the National Wildlife Refuge Association's board of directors. The resident of Santa Barbara, California, and longtime conservation professional was tapped for the leadership position during the association's board meeting last month at the Deer Flat National Wildlife Refuge in Nampa, Idaho. A self-described birder and avid hiker, Scarlett has served several stints as a board member of the association. She retired in December 2021 as global chief external affairs officer at The Nature Conservancy.
